City Guide
Yiwu, Zhejiang, China
Overview
Yiwu is a lively trading hub in Zhejiang Province, best known for its massive International Trade City, the world's largest small commodities market. The city attracts business travelers and entrepreneurs from across the globe, yet also offers inviting local neighborhoods and cultural experiences.
Best Time to Visit
March-May for mild spring weather and September-November for comfortable autumn temperatures.
Local Tips
Carry cash for local markets; ride-hailing apps like Didi are widely used; English is limited outside business areas, so translation apps are handy.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ping isn't customary; dress is casual but respectful; expect to exchange business cards with both hands during meetings.
Safety Warnings
Stay alert in crowded market areas for pickpockets; avoid unregistered taxis; tap water isn't potable, so use bottled water.
Hidden Gems
Yiwu Museum with local history exhibits, Xiuhu Park for tranquil lakeside walks, and Fotang Ancient Town for Qing Dynasty architecture and authentic street food.
